
JDBC入门指南:连接与操作数据库的Java标准API
下载需积分: 10 | 1.45MB |
更新于2024-07-24
| 114 浏览量 | 举报
收藏
JDBC是Java Database Connectivity的缩写,它是Java平台与各种数据库系统进行交互的标准API。对于初学者和菜鸟来说,理解JDBC的基本使用方法是非常重要的。JDBC的核心概念包括以下几个方面:
1. JDBC编程基础:JDBC提供了一套API,允许Java开发者编写与数据库交互的代码,实现对SQL语句的执行、管理连接、执行事务等功能。
2. JDBC概述:JDBC通过JDBC驱动程序(包括类型1、2、3和4)与数据库连接,每种类型有其特定的连接方式。- 类型1(JDBC/ODBC桥)利用ODBC桥接数据库;- 类型2是纯Java驱动,通过本地库;- 类型3通过中间件服务器;- 类型4则是直接连接数据库的Java实现。
3. JDBC类和接口:核心的JDBC类和接口包括`java.sql.Driver`接口,它是所有JDBC驱动程序的统一规范,负责驱动程序的加载和注册;`java.sql.DriverManager`类用于管理和获取数据库连接;`java.sql.Connection`接口表示数据库连接,`Statement`接口用于执行SQL语句,`ResultSet`接口用于处理查询结果,而`SQLException`类则处理可能出现的错误和异常。
4. 包含在Java.sql和Javax.sql包中的类,如`Connection`、`Statement`和`ResultSet`,都是为了方便开发者编写可移植的应用程序,它们提供了数据库操作的通用接口,使得代码无需关心底层数据库的具体实现。
5. 使用JDBC时,通常会使用`Class.forName()`方法动态加载和注册驱动程序,确保了应用程序对不同数据库的兼容性。
掌握JDBC的关键在于理解它的基本工作原理,熟练使用这些核心类和接口,以及如何根据不同类型的驱动程序选择合适的连接方式。通过实践,开发人员可以灵活地在Java项目中集成各种数据库系统,实现数据访问和操作的功能。此外,理解错误处理和异常处理也是使用JDBC时不可或缺的部分,这有助于提高代码的健壮性和可靠性。
相关推荐
















猎豹001
- 粉丝: 0
最新资源
- 2021开源峰会:年度最受欢迎文章精选
- 房地产数字化转型案例分析与数据治理
- 微信小程序合成大西瓜游戏源码分析
- 阿里云点播上传工具包的导入与使用
- 全面掌握Git安装包下载攻略
- Java XML-Repair工具类,高效修复XML文件
- GNS3虚拟机模式安装指南及组件选择要点
- 技术分析之物料筛选图高效应用策略
- 全新升级版博客天空网站目录导航源码发布
- 64位谷歌浏览器103版发布,新特性解读
- 64位谷歌浏览器71.0.3578.80版本发布
- MIP自适应小说站程序:自动采集、免维护、SEO优化
- 探索新版.netFramework源码的奥秘
- Matlab实现熵权TOPSIS算法教程
- VfpexeNc加密工具:彻底保护VFP应用程序
- 随波逐流CTF编码工具发布3.2版,支持多样化编码解码
- H5页面在微信小程序中的判断示例
- Java工程操作Docker容器指南
- 最新SPSS软件绿色版下载指南
- 2023合肥工业大学考研初复试要求全览
- 全球平台TEE与SE规范集大揭秘
- 微信截图一键识别文字并输出到终端工具
- 华为LIO-AN00m设备的2022年9月16日bug报告分析
- 免费PDF转换工具:将PDF转换为Word和Excel